It is powered by an 8 horsepower diesel, air‑cooled engine designed to deliver strong performance for tilling, ditching and general soil preparation.
The tiller offers flexible starting methods: a pull (recoil) start and an electric start, so you can choose the most convenient option for the conditions.
The product includes four interchangeable tools/implements. Exact tool types included can vary by seller or package; check the product listing or contact your dealer for the specific implements provided with your unit.
It uses a belt drive transmission that provides smooth, reliable power transfer while minimizing wear and simplifying repairs and maintenance.
The adjustable depth range is 10–20 cm, allowing you to set appropriate tilling depth for different soil preparations and crop needs.
The tiller weighs approximately 60 kg, making it relatively lightweight and compact for a diesel unit. It is designed for easy maneuvering and convenient storage for small to medium plots.
It's ideal for small to medium-sized farms, gardens and allotments. Typical tasks include primary and secondary tilling, ridge and ditch formation, seedbed preparation and light land leveling.

Routine maintenance includes checking/changing engine oil, inspecting and cleaning the air filter, checking and adjusting belt tension, greasing moving parts, tightening fasteners, and inspecting tines and attachments. Follow the service intervals and oil/fluids specified in the operator manual.

Wear appropriate PPE (sturdy footwear, eye protection, hearing protection), keep bystanders and children away, never operate on overly steep slopes, shut off the engine before servicing or adjusting, avoid loose clothing near moving parts, and follow all safety instructions in the manual.
Yes, the engine is air‑cooled, which eliminates the need for a liquid cooling system and reduces maintenance related to radiators and coolant. Ensure cooling fins and air intake areas are kept clean and free of debris to prevent overheating.
